HONOLULU (HawaiiNewsNow) - Seven Hawaiʻi governors are supporting Kamehameha Schools’ admission policy in a letter to the editor after the school was sued for discrimination by Students for Fair Admissions.

All seven Hawaiʻi governors, from current Gov. Josh Green to George Ariyoshi, 99, said some wrongly seek to undermine Princess Bernice Pauahi’s vision by forcing Kamehameha Schools to disregard her 1883 directive giving preference to Native Hawaiians.

“Her Trustees’ efforts to honor that directive are under attack,” the governors wrote.

“She gave her legacy to ensure the perpetuation of a people,” said former Gov. John Waiheʻe.
